All except nine of the province’s 625 nursing homes have air conditioning in the rooms of residents, nearly one year after the Ford government’s deadline.
Long-Term Care Minister Paul Calandra says three of the nine are expected to have units installed by the end of this month, three are on track to have A-C this summer, two homes have electrical capacity issues, however are being re-developed and will eventually have it.
The province has given those eight homes exemptions and recently fined a ninth one.
A law in 2021 required homes to install air conditioning in all residents rooms by last June.
The government recently passed regulations allowing it to issue higher fines to homes that are not in compliance.
